Output debb706f4c24b516690309cc8e4c98c163a91469443a370d238370ce21078179:0

value
66892
script pubkey
OP_HASH160 OP_PUSHBYTES_20 1d8afb1a5ddbd7ea85a3e722cdfaa22fd789a43c OP_EQUAL
address
2MuwS5QaEXsofZGU9BwJxAg1rnnWTLPQqMs
transaction
debb706f4c24b516690309cc8e4c98c163a91469443a370d238370ce21078179